Clinical/Medical Social Work Schools in Nebraska
123 students earned Clinical/Medical Social Work degrees in Nebraska in the 2022-2023 year.
As a degree choice, Clinical/Medical Social Work is the 107th most popular major in the state.
Education Levels of Clinical/Medical Social Work Majors in Nebraska
Clinical/Medical Social Work maj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:
| Education Level | Number of Grads |
|---|---|
| Associate Degree | 63 |
| Award Taking Less Than 1 Year | 38 |
| Award Taking 1 to 2 Years | 22 |
| Award Taking 2 to 4 Years | 22 |

Racial Distribution
The racial distribution of clinical/medical social work majors in Nebraska is as follows:
- Asian: 0.0%
- Black or African American: 8.1%
- Hispanic or Latino: 12.2%
- White: 68.3%
- Non-Resident Alien: 0.0%
- Other Races: 11.4%
Jobs for Clinical/Medical Social Work Grads in Nebraska
There are 1,550 people in the state and 297,560 people in the nation working in clinical/medical social work jobs.
Wages for Clinical/Medical Social Work Jobs in Nebraska
In this state, clinical/medical social work grads earn an average of $48,230. Nationwide, they make an average of $58,470.

Request InformationClinical/Medical Social Work Careers in NE
Some of the careers clinical/medical social work majors go into include:
| Job Title | NE Job Growth | NE Median Salary |
|---|---|---|
| Social Work Professors | 17% | $58,560 |
| Healthcare Social Workers | 15% | $47,130 |
